About this role
Sarah Noel Interiors, a luxury home staging and interior design firm based in Denver, is hiring a Staging Manager. This role combines operations and on-site execution, managing the complete project lifecycle from scheduling and inventory preparation through installation, de-staging, and reset while maintaining warehouse systems and workflows.
The Staging Manager will oversee scheduling and logistics for all installs and de-stages, lead staging days on-site to execute design plans and conduct quality checks before photography, make real-time problem-solving decisions during installations, and keep agents, sellers, and vendors informed of timing and access. The position also covers inventory management including receiving and tagging new pieces, inspecting furniture after each de-stage, identifying damages, tracking discrepancies, ensuring all items are cleaned and repaired, maintaining accurate records in inventory systems, and keeping the warehouse organized and ready. Truck pack-outs, vehicle security, charging, and equipment readiness fall within this role's scope.
Day-to-day administrative duties include managing scheduling and project tracking, conducting data entry across Airtable, Google Workspace, and inventory systems, drafting client communications and follow-ups, identifying process improvements, and completing shopping runs for staging furniture, décor, and supplies with organized receipt tracking. During higher-volume design seasons, the role expands to include order management for design projects, vendor coordination, expediting with vendors to keep projects on track, and sourcing support for procurement and design presentations.
Qualifications include four or more years of professional staging experience with demonstrated project and operations management. Candidates must be highly organized, possess a strong design eye aligned with the luxury market, take ownership of outcomes rather than just tasks, communicate clearly with clients and vendors, and be physically capable of install days involving lifting and loading. A clean driving record and comfort driving cargo vans or box trucks is required, as is a reliable personal vehicle with capacity to transport staging bins and accessories between locations, with mileage reimbursement provided. Background in interior design or design-adjacent fields such as event planning or set design is preferred, as is familiarity with Airtable, Zapier, Google Suite, Stageforce, Hutch, 17Hats, DesignFiles, or Slack. Sophisticated knowledge of the luxury market is a plus.
Sarah Noel Interiors offers a salary of $30 to $40 per hour depending on experience, full-time Monday through Friday work with flexible scheduling as needed, and the opportunity to see results on MLS listings, in publications, and at open houses throughout Colorado.
